EL PASO, Texas (KTSM) — A family member of the missing 14-year-old girl that the El Paso Police Department reported as a runaway on Thursday, Jan. 29, told KTSM she is back home with family as of Saturday, Jan. 31.

No other details were provided at the time.

After the family confirmed to KTSM, El Paso police announced on its social media account that Zury Talamantes was located and safe with her family.

The Texas Department of Public Safety had issued an Amber Alert for Talamantes around 5:30 p.m. on Jan. 30, stating that law enforcement officials believed she may be in grave or immediate danger.
